As you have learned first hand, making decisions based on scientific research and claims requires careful and thoughtful analyses. Decisions based on scientific evidence are not always as clear as checking results against the predictions of  textbook formula. Scientists and decision makers must be able to weigh complex and often contradictory evidence from many sources.

Making difficult decisions in a committee by consensus can be a difficult process. Consensus decisions require committee members to trust each other to work together. A committee working towards a consensus is usually working to find an acceptable compromise. The committee reaches a decision and all committee members are at least somewhat comfortable and can support  the product of the committee effort.

The skills you learned involving data evaluation and consensus building are common to many teams in private industry, government, civic and social organizations. Now you are ready to do this again in real life.
